これはウェブ上の回答を見つけることができないようです。電子メニューの項目を無効にすることができません
電子メニューを無効にしようとしましたが、クリックイベントで失敗しました。
コードはmenuItem.enable = false;
のようなものですが、動作しません。コンソールログを作成しようとしましたが、例外もエラーもなくすべてうまくいくようです。
これはウェブ上の回答を見つけることができないようです。電子メニューの項目を無効にすることができません
電子メニューを無効にしようとしましたが、クリックイベントで失敗しました。
コードはmenuItem.enable = false;
のようなものですが、動作しません。コンソールログを作成しようとしましたが、例外もエラーもなくすべてうまくいくようです。
electron apiで検索できます。
@ zer09がコメントとしてちょうどそれが
menuItem.enabled = false;
あるべきドキュメントは、これは言う:
は、ブール(オプション)を有効に - falseの場合、メニュー項目はグレー表示とunclickableされます。
これは、/を使用しているときには動作しないようです:メニューがメインで作成されたときに、レンダラープロセスからメニュー項目を無効にすることができません。 – knut
私は悪いことに、 '' 'enabled'''ではなく' '' enable'''でなければなりません。 – zer09